Flowise: `DELETE /api/v1/chatflows/:id` does not validate resource type, allowing `agentflows:delete` and `chatflows:delete` to delete each other’s flow type
Summary
Flowise is a drag & drop user interface to build a customized large language model flow. Prior to 3.1.3, `DELETE /api/v1/chatflows/:id` authorized requests with checkAnyPermission('chatflows:delete,agentflows:delete'), so possession of either permission was sufficient to reach the delete path. The delete logic then resolved the target record only by id and workspaceId and did not validate the target resource type, allowing a caller with only agentflows:delete to delete a CHATFLOW and a caller with only chatflows:delete to delete an AGENTFLOW in the same workspace. This issue is fixed in version 3.1.3.

Apache NiFi: Authorization Bypass for Parameter Context Asset Deletion
Summary
Apache NiFi 2.0.0 through 2.10.0 support creating, reading, and deleting Assets associated with Parameter Contexts through the REST API. The framework authorizes asset deletion against the owning Parameter Context using the supplied Parameter Context Identifier and Asset Identifier. The framework performed authorized based on the supplied Parameter Context Identifier without verifying the requested Identifier against the stored Identifier. Apache NiFi installations that do not implement different levels of authorization across Parameter Contexts are not subject to this vulnerability, because the framework enforces write permissions as the security boundary. Upgrading to Apache NiFi 2.11.0 is the recommended mitigation, which verifies Parameter Context ownership of the requested Asset before deletion using the same strategy applied to Asset read operations.

Vikunja 0.22.0 through 2.3.0 Authentication Bypass via Principal ID Collision
Summary
Vikunja versions 0.22.0 through 2.3.0 fail to validate the principal type in API token management. Because user IDs and link-share IDs are independent numeric sequences and both resolve through a generic web.Auth.GetID() interface, a link-share JWT whose numeric ID equals a target user's ID is treated as that user by the /api/v1/tokens endpoints. An authenticated attacker can obtain a target's numeric user ID via authenticated user search, then create link shares on an attacker-writable project until the link-share sequence reaches that value, and use the resulting link-share JWT to list, create, and delete the target user's API tokens (including issuing a new token with attacker-chosen scopes under the target's permissions). Fixed in version 2.4.0.

Wekan: a low-privilege board member escalates to board admin and takes over a private board via the `sort` collection-allow rule
Summary
Wekan is open source kanban built with Meteor. Prior to 9.89, the second Boards.allow({ update }) rule in server/permissions/boards.js called canUpdateBoardSort in server/lib/utils.js, which authorized any board member whenever fieldNames included sort. Because Meteor combines allow rules with OR semantics and applies the complete modifier, a comment-only or read-only member could send one Boards.update with $set values for sort, members, permission, and title, make themselves the sole board administrator, expose a private board, and evict the legitimate owner; the last-admin deny rule inspected only $pull and did not block a wholesale $set of members. Version 9.89 requires sort to be the only modified field and rejects $set member arrays that remove the last active administrator. This issue is fixed in version 9.89.

Mitigation
Architecture and Design
  • Divide the product into anonymous, normal, privileged, and administrative areas. Reduce the attack surface by carefully mapping roles with data and functionality. Use role-based access control (RBAC) [REF-229] to enforce the roles at the appropriate boundaries.
  • Note that this approach may not protect against horizontal authorization, i.e., it will not protect a user from attacking others with the same role.
Mitigation
Architecture and Design

Ensure that access control checks are performed related to the business logic. These checks may be different than the access control checks that are applied to more generic resources such as files, connections, processes, memory, and database records. For example, a database may restrict access for medical records to a specific database user, but each record might only be intended to be accessible to the patient and the patient's doctor [REF-7].

Mitigation MIT-4.4
Architecture and Design

Strategy: Libraries or Frameworks

  • Use a vetted library or framework that does not allow this weakness to occur or provides constructs that make this weakness easier to avoid.
  • For example, consider using authorization frameworks such as the JAAS Authorization Framework [REF-233] and the OWASP ESAPI Access Control feature [REF-45].
Mitigation
Architecture and Design
  • For web applications, make sure that the access control mechanism is enforced correctly at the server side on every page. Users should not be able to access any unauthorized functionality or information by simply requesting direct access to that page.
  • One way to do this is to ensure that all pages containing sensitive information are not cached, and that all such pages restrict access to requests that are accompanied by an active and authenticated session token associated with a user who has the required permissions to access that page.
Mitigation
System Configuration Installation

Use the access control capabilities of your operating system and server environment and define your access control lists accordingly. Use a "default deny" policy when defining these ACLs.
